Are you looking for Christian counseling in Tucson? Do you want to address mental health from a Biblical perspective, incorporating prayer, Scripture, and Godly truths about your identity in Christ?

Our mission at Joshua Tree Counseling is to help clients move from hopeless to healing and from surviving to thriving. We are home to a collective of counselors who are mature Christian believers. We offer professional counseling, addiction counseling, trauma therapy, marriage counseling, teen counseling, soul care, and life coaching. We offer both in-person and online counseling options.

Joshua Tree is a cozy, home-like counseling setting where you learn to manage your mental and emotional pain; address an addiction; restore your marriage; grieve a loss; find hope for your teen; or heal your trauma.

My Christian Faith and My Professional Practice

When you're ready to begin counseling, it can be overwhelming to choose the right person to help. A person’s faith is often the most important aspect in the search for a counselor. This may be because your faith is central to who you are and you can't imagine separating faith and counseling. You may want your issue to be viewed through a Biblical lens and wish to receive guidance in accordance with God’s Word. Perhaps you're seeking a counselor who is a Christian because you want to know your foundational beliefs align even though you aren't necessarily looking for prayer and Scripture to be integrated into the counseling experience. Maybe you find yourself in a faith crisis or you’ve been wounded by people who profess to be Christians but seem to be hypocritical or have been abusive. Perhaps you were raised in a Christian home but felt it was too legalistic.

Whether the Christian faith is your greatest asset or the thing that has most wounded you, if you are looking for a counselor who has a solid understanding of the Bible, the gospel, and how to integrate the Christian faith into mental health counseling, Joshua Tree may be just what you're looking for!
